Sony has launched its MHC-V82D, MHC-V72D, MHC-V42D and MHC-V02 party speakers in India. The MHC-V82D and MHC-V72D boast of 360-degree surround sound feature, with the brand claiming that each speaker is engineered with rear tweeters, angled speakers, and a spread sound generator, allowing sound to reach all corners of the room. The Sony V82D, V72D, and V42D speakers’ lighting syncs to the beat and the Jet Bass Booster creates clear, deep, and space-filling bass.

The speakers also come with mic inputs and a Karaoke mode for singing sessions. They also come with three other modes – ‘Clean’ for a clear sound, ‘Overdrive’ for a distorted guitar sound, and ‘Bass’ for your bass guitar. Sony has also introduced a LIVE SOUND mode with V82D, V72D and V42D speakers. This mode creates a wider sound stage thanks to Digital Signal Processing technology, producing a three-dimensional sound. 

The Sony V82D and V72D speakers let you play your own beat with the Taiko Mode. You can add your own drumming, play along with bongo, djembe surdo, and the Japanese Taiko drum just by tapping the top panel in time to the beat. They also come with splash-proof top panel with LED touch and motion control. The speakers also rock gesture control, including the new vertical style gesture to change the music and mic pitch. Users can also control the party lighting from a smartphone through the Fiestable app and even supports voice control for hands-free communication.

The Sony MHC-V82D speaker is priced at Rs 52,990, the MHC-V72D costs Rs 42,990, while the MHC-V42D sets you back by Rs 29,990 and the MHC-V02 is priced at Rs 15,990. The speakers will be available across all Sony Centers, major electronic stores and e-
commerce platforms in India later this week.
